Buscar

Programação cliente servidor1 1

Prévia do material em texto

07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 1/7 
 
 
 
 
 
Disc.: PROGRAMAÇÃO CLIENTE SERVIDOR 
Aluno(a): 
Acertos: 10 , 0 de 10,0 07/09/2022 
 
 
Acerto: 1 , 0 / 0 1 , 
Considerando o fragmento de código abaixo, em relação ao escopo de variáveis 
em Javascript, assinale a afirmativa correta. 
 
Serão impressos undefined e undefined; 
Serão impressos 5 e 5; 
 Serão impressos 1 e undefined; 
Serão impressos 6 e 4; 
Serão impressos 1 e -1; 
Respondido em 07/09/2022 13:51:35 
 
 
Explicação: 
A resposta correta é: Serão impressos 1 e undefined; 
 
 
Acerto: 1 , 0 / 1 , 0 
Considere o bloco de código abaixo que utiliza JavaScript e JSON. 
 
 
 
 
07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 2/7 
 
Para que o bloco de código exiba 0146 vermelha, a lacuna I deve ser corretamente 
preenchida por: 
 text.trens[1].trem + " " + text.trens[1].linha 
 x.trens[trem] + " " + x.trens[linha] 
 x.trens[2].trem + " " + x.trens[2].linha 
 text.trens[trem] + " " + text.trens[linha] 
x.trens[1].trem + " " + x.trens[1].linha 
Respondido em 07/09/2022 13:51:57 
 
 
 
 
 
É correto afirmar que o código apresentado acima: 
 cria um array com três objetos e atribui dados a eles. 
 concatena três arrays em um objeto e atribui dados a ele. 
 divide um objeto em três strings e atribui dados a elas. 
 concatena três objetos formando uma classe e atribui 
dados a ela. concatena três string formando uma classe 
e atribui dados a ela. 
Respondido em 07/09/2022 13:29:53 
 
 
 
 
 
 
Explicação: 
A resposta correta é: x.trens[1].trem + " " + x.trens[1].linha 
 
Acerto: 1 , 0 / 1 , 0 
Dado o seguinte código JSON com Javascript: 
 
 
 
Explicação: 
A resposta correta é: cria um array com três objetos e atribui dados a eles. 
 
Acerto: 1 , 0 / 1 , 0 
 
07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 3/7 
Assinale a opção que representa um exemplo correto de dados escritos no formato 
YAML: 
 
 
07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 4/7 
 
Respondido em 07/09/2022 13:30:33 
 
 
 
 
 
Explicação: 
A resposta correta é: 
 
Acerto: 1 , 0 / 1 , 0 
 
07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 5/7 
 Questão 
Analise as afirmativas sobre Servlets: 
I - A tecnologia Java Servlet utiliza a plataforma Java para criar páginas web 
dinâmicasem aplicações independentes de plataforma. 
 
II - Um componente de Servlet é uma classe que estende (herda) de HttpServlet. 
 
III - A tecnologia se baseia na construção de classes, sendo executada ao níveldo 
cliente, no navegador. 
 Somente a II está correta. 
 Todas as afirmativas estão corretas. 
 Somente a III está correta. 
 Somente I e II estão corretas. 
 Somente a I está correta. 
Respondido em 07/09/2022 13:52:37 
 
 
 
 
Quando lidamos com SQL, temos comandos denominados DML, ou linguagem de manipulação de dados, 
como INSERT, UPDATE e DELETE, voltados para a manutenção dos dados presentes na tabela, e efetuamos 
consultas através do comando SELECT, talvez o mais relevante do SQL. Para executar comandos DML a 
partir de um Statement, qual método deveria ser utilizado para manipulação de dados? 
createStatement. 
open. 
getConnection. 
executeQuery. 
executeUpdate. 
Respondido em 07/09/2022 13:52:41 
 
 
 
 
 
Ao trabalhar com um aplicativo corporativo, segundo a arquitetura MVC, as 
camadas Model e Controller são definidas ao nível do projeto interno com o terminador 
"ejb", e o NetBeans oferece ferramentas de automatização para a geração dos 
componentes necessários, com utilização de duas tecnologias específicas. Quais são as 
tecnologias utilizadas para as duas camadas citadas, respectivamente? 
 JSP e Servlet 
 JPA e JSP 
 EJB e Servlet 
 
Explicação: 
A resposta correta é: Somente I e II estão corretas. 
 
Acerto: 1 , 0 / 1 , 0 
 
Explicação: 
A resposta correta é: executeUpdate. As consultas ao banco são feitas com a utilização de executeQuery, mas 
os comandos para manipulação de dados são executados através de executeUpdate. 
 
Acerto: 1 , 0 / 1 , 0 
 
 
07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 6/7 
 Servlet e JPA 
 JPA e EJB 
Respondido em 07/09/2022 13:52:46 
 
 
 
 
A arquitetura MVC (Model, View e Controller) é utilizada de forma ampla, na criação de 
sistemas cadastrais, e caracteriza-se pela divisão do sistema em três camadas, com 
objetivos específicos. Considerando a divisão utilizada pelo MVC, a interface de usuário 
e o componente DAO estariam, respectivamente, nas camadas: 
 Model e Controller 
 View e Controller 
 Model e View 
 View e Model 
 Controller e Model 
Respondido em 07/09/2022 13:52:53 
 
 
 
 
Um web service em Java é um programa cujos métodos públicos são acessados por 
aplicações remotas. Utiliza como base protocolos como SOAP e HTTP. É correto afirmar 
que: 
 Um web service, para ser utilizado, precisa estar ativo esperando requisições. 
Para isso, é empregado um servidor para esta tecnologia. Esse procedimento é 
semelhante ao utilizado pelos servlets e páginas JSP, que necessitam de um 
servidor específico para fornecer o serviço desejado. 
 Um web service, para ser utilizado, precisa ser compilado na linguagem 
Intel assembly e empregado em um servidor para esta tecnologia. Esse 
procedimento é semelhante ao utilizado pelos servlets e páginas JSP que 
necessitam de um servidor específico para fornecer o serviço desejado. 
 Um web service, para ser utilizado, precisa ser escrito com o protocolo 
SOAP encapsulado numa conexão IMAP. Esse procedimento é semelhante 
ao utilizado pelos servlets e páginas JSP que necessitam de um servidor 
específico para fornecer o serviço desejado. 
 Um web service, para ser utilizado, precisa ser ativado por um serviço da 
plataforma Windows ou pelo daemon inetd da plataforma Unix, 
encapsulado 
numa conexão TELNET. Esse procedimento é semelhante ao utilizado pelos 
serviços de backup que necessitam de autorização de usuário. 
 Um web service, para ser utilizado, precisa ser carregado por um daemon 
que aguarda requisições. Para isso, é empregado um servidor 
multiplataforma. Esse procedimento é semelhante ao utilizado pelos 
serviços de proxy que necessitam de autenticação de usuário. 
Respondido em 07/09/2022 13:53:00 
 
Explicação: 
A resposta correta é: JPA e EJB 
 
Acerto: 1 , 0 / 1 , 0 
 
 
Explicação: 
A resposta correta é: View e Model 
 
Acerto: 1 , 0 / 1 , 0 
 
 
07/09/2022 13:54 Estácio: Alunos 
https://simulado.estacio.br/alunos/ 7/7 
 
 
Explicação: 
A resposta correta é: Um web service, para ser utilizado, precisa estar ativo 
esperando requisições. Para isso, é empregado um servidor para esta 
tecnologia. Esse procedimento é semelhante ao utilizado pelos servlets e 
páginas JSP, que necessitam de um servidor específico para fornecer o serviço 
desejado. 
 
 
Um serviço REST usualmente suporta mais de um formato para representação de seus 
recursos, sendo esta uma de suas características principais, já que facilita a inclusão 
de novos clientes e a interoperabilidade entre os projetos. Assinale a alternativa que 
apresenta somente formatos utilizados por um serviço REST. 
 JAVA, RUBY ON REALS e .NET. 
 XML e C++. 
 JSON, CSS e SQL. 
 YAML e JSON. 
 JAVA e JAVASCRIPT. 
Respondido em 07/09/2022 13:53:06 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
Acerto: 1 , 0 / 1 , 0 
 
 
Explicação: 
A resposta correta é: YAML e JSON.

Continue navegando